My dad has given me some figures to sell for him I would like to get him the best prices for them but not sure where to advertise or is eBay my best bet?

Dave
 
That depends on what the figures are really, I mean if they are boxed original Star Wars figures then Ebay is a good bet due to the global audience. Don't forget with Ebay you can set a minimum price. You do get specialist toy auctions from time to time at some auction houses, but they are usually only held a couple of times a year, alternatively you have the dedicated toy auction houses where possibly you would get to sell to serious collectors, if something is particularly sought after and two collectors want it then the price can often go above the estimate. One thing you can do is check out the 'sold' listings for the figures you want to sell and see what prices they have sold for recently, that will give you a good idea what their value is to other collectors.
